Tonight Aaron Fillion was one second off of the course record of 18:18 which he set on 2010-Aug-05, while Sue Schlatter, who had set the female course record of 19:52 on 2010-Aug-12, nearly did another sub 20 minute 15km, landing instead on 20:00 even. I bet that they both wished that the volunteers were just a little quicker at pushing their buttons at the finish line! Both of these times were excellent considering that it was yet another difficult night - cool with fairly high air pressure and winds which didn't diminish during the time trial. You can get a quick idea of how good a night is and how you did relative to the conditions by looking at the EvtFactor shown after the date and your performance ratio relative to your previous season/series best 15km and see how they compare. Tonight only nine people managed to improve upon their season series best while 8 bettered and 2 tied their previous 15km database best.
